So many of us struggle with “productivity shame”-- the feeling that we’re failing because we can’t stay consistent. Maybe our systems and schedules look good on paper, but leave us feeling exhausted, guilty, or burnt out. The truth? Our daily actions are in a constant tug-of-war with our souls. This week, on episode 296 of the Positively LivingⓇ Podcast, I am kicking off a special series guiding you through my Positively Productive Toolkit, starting with the foundational element of sustainable productivity: core values.
In this episode of the Positively LivingⓇ Podcast, I’m sharing how you can identify the fundamental beliefs that guide your behavior and how to use them as a “filter” to sift through the noise of the world.
Key Takeaways:
- Your values are the ultimate decision-maker for feeling grounded (instead of drained) in your efforts.
- Resistance and inconsistency are often linked to a lack of alignment.
- Learn how to narrow a list of ideals into five essential anchor values that represent your most authentic self.
- Shift your perspective from who you “should” be to who you actually are, allowing you to create a life that honors your energy and capacity.
